Description
This Czech-language book presents sex as a dialogue that people have not yet learned to conduct properly. Sexual communication is often more physical than verbal and burdened by shame, prejudice and unspoken fears, even though words, tone of voice, rhythm of speech and sharing feelings activate the brain’s centres of desire, trust and intimacy. Couples who talk about sex have better sex and stronger relationships. The book shows how to turn silence into closeness, shame into courage and conflict into a new beginning. Its model conversations, presented between a man and a woman as the most common arrangement in society, can also inspire homosexual and transgender couples. The dialogues demonstrate how to prevent conflict or use it constructively, find a path toward understanding one’s own and one’s partner’s desires, and develop intimacy within a relationship. Readers are encouraged to talk about their feelings, listen to their partner, be honest, avoid manipulation, and treat each other with mutual respect, consideration and patience.
